## Step 4: Verify descriptor hygiene before cutover

Before migrating the Lanternfish ingest workers to the new pool, confirm the old leaked-descriptor bug is fully patched. Run the sweep tool against a staging worker for at least an hour and watch the open-handle count — it should plateau, not climb. Historically the leak came from abandoned pipe pairs in the retry path, so pay special attention after forced timeouts. Once the plateau holds, copy the hardened settings into place. The configuration the migrated workers must use is as follows.

settings of tagef-bawif:
DRUIX_HOST=druix.zemvarlabs.internal
DRUIX_PORT=8000

# Provenance: Gatewick Quota Service

Per-tenant rate quotas live in the Gatewick service. Quota tables ship inside the build artifact — never edited live. Every change goes through the Millbrace pipeline: signed commit, reproducible build, attested artifact. No exceptions, no hotfix uploads. To verify what a tenant is actually running, compare their reported version against the release ledger. Contractors: do not trust runtime config dumps; trust the artifact. The attested identifier for the current production build follows.

session token of yaduf-kawip = htk6_fc5a05

## 3.8.0 — User module split

Welcome aboard! As part of carving the user module out of the Dunmere monolith, `DM_AUTH_KEY` was renamed to reflect the new `userhub` service ownership. Old name is dead as of this release — the monolith no longer reads it. Update your local env file: delete the old entry and add the replacement line below, which sets the userhub signing secret:

env line for yahip-tafog: RELAY_SECRET3=4ca